English: U.S. Fleet Cyber Command Sailor of the Year (SOY) nominees stand with Vice Adm. Jan E. Tighe, commander U.S. Fleet Cyber Command/U.S. 10th Fleet, during a ceremony at Fort Meade on Feb. 5 to announce the command's shore and sea Sailors of the Year. During the ceremony, Tighe announced Cryptologic Technician (Collection) 1st Class (IDW/NAC/AW) Arturo L. Livingston, assigned to Navy Information Operations Command Whidbey Island, as the sea SOY and Navy Counselor 1st Class (IDW/AW) Skye L. Pollard, assigned to Navy Information Operations Command Maryland, as the shore SOY.
